Michael Carrick’s reputation at Middlesbrough has now been revealed after the appointment of the Manchester United legend as interim boss at Old Trafford.
The 44-year-old former England midfielder had served under both Ole Gunnar Solskjaer and Jose Mourinho in the Manchester United coaching staff in the past.

Michael Carrick initially served as United caretaker manager in 2021 after Ole Gunnar Solskjaer was sacked and before Ralf Rangnick was appointed as interim head coach.
The United legend left Old Trafford after his caretaker spell and Carrick took his first steps into management by becoming the manager of Middlesbrough in 2022.
Carrick impressed during his spell with Middlesbrough and ensured that the Championship outfit escaped a relegation battle in his debut season at the club.

What Middlesbrough thought about Michael Carrick during his managerial spell at the Championship outfit
Michael Carrick enjoyed both the highs and lows during his time at the Riverside Stadium, including leading Middlesbrough to the Carabao Cup semi-finals in 2024.
The former Middlesbrough head coach also missed out on taking the Championship side to the Premier League final after a play-off semi-final defeat in 2023.

Carrick committed his future to the Riverside Stadium back in 2024, but the former Manchester United star’s managerial run at Middlesbrough ended last summer.
BBC Sport has now reported that a Middlesbrough ‘insider’ revealed that the Man Utd legend was deeply “loved” by everyone around him at the Championship club.
“Never too up, never too down,” the unnamed source told the publication.
“That is Michael. He doesn’t waste 10 words when one will do. At Middlesbrough, everyone loved him.”
Michael Carrick’s Middlesbrough experience is now invaluable for his Man Utd interim managerial spell
Carrick was sacked by Middlesbrough in 2025 and the former Three Lions international will now return to the managerial dugout for the first time in 2026.
Man Utd have turned to Carrick and appointed the ex-Middlesbrough head coach as the interim Red Devils manager until the end of the 2025-26 Premier League season.

Carrick’s United interim spell will last 17 Premier League matches in the current campaign and is not expected to extend beyond the summer at Old Trafford.
Ineos are now on the hunt for a new permanent manager at the Premier League club after Ruben Amorim was sacked as United head coach last week.
Amorim’s 14-month Man Utd reign ended after the Red Devils’ 1-1 draw against Leeds United and Darren Fletcher briefly took charge as caretaker manager.
